Drive For Show, Putt For Dough


There is another stat that folks look to actually focus on. What's it? Putts. Now that's putts, a huge one.

You constantly hear people referring to their putting. How many putts they'd in their round. I 'd 35 putts. Boy I had a terrible putting day today I 'd 40 putts. Again, this is the right info, but is it... Would you like to enhance your setting, keep reading. Putting is among those stats that can be quite deceptive. One day you and you have 26 putts and 36 putts, respectively. Not much great info there. On putting the advice can get quite skewed. Why? GIR is the key.So you've that putting day, with 25 putts and you just hit 5 GIR. Seems to me like you got down and up quite a bit. The ball close was chipping, and making the short putts. Perhaps they were tap.

Is this currently putting tips of 25 putts any great? Well not actually. You had a lousy day hitting on the greens and your chipping was red hot. You do not have to work on your chipping, that is for sure. But you might want to work in your iron play assaulting the greens. If you must enhance your putting you've got no means to understand with this info. I trust you see what I mean here.

The Secret to Gathering the Right Putting Stat


Here is a superb putting this and suggestion will tell you if you need some putting education. What stat that is setting is a great stat that is putting? Now that's the question that is actual and I 've the answer for you.

You need to count your putts which you hit in regulation. What do I mean? Let us use the preceding example of hitting on 5 greens in regulation. The GIR stat stinks and can be improved upon although, you can nevertheless put it to use for something. Yet many GIR you've got note how many putts you'd on that hole especially. So for example, 5 GIR and you'd 11 putts. This stat is not a little better than typical. That would be a lot better if you'd 9 putts. You'd the remaining other 4 holes you two putt and a 1 putt. This is a stat that you monitor and can actually use.
